    How to Repair a uPVC Window Frame

    Upvc windows can last for decades. However, with time, they may be damaged.

    This can impact the performance of windows. Fortunately, a lot of these issues can be fixed. This will save money on new windows, and improve your home's comfort. Some of the most common problems include:

    Cracks

    uPVC is a preferred material for window frames because it's long-lasting and energy efficient, however it is susceptible to cracking over time. A cracked window is more than just an eye-sore. It can also let cold air into your home and increase your energy bills as heat escapes through the crack. However, it is possible to fix a uPVC window frame without spending a lot of money, and it could be done fairly quickly.

    The root of the crack is the first step. It could be caused by a sudden shift in pressure, for instance when you open or close the window. This kind of crack is known as"pressure crack" and is usually found near the edges of the window. The crack should be fixed as soon as you can, as it could lead to water leakage or draughts.

    A window frame that is not aligned properly is another common cause of cracks on your uPVC windows. This could be due to moving furniture, moving into a new property or even weather conditions like freezing temperatures. It's simple to address this issue by drilling some pilot holes and then running a line of silicone across the gap. This will block any moisture from entering the window.

    To keep your uPVC window frames looking good and performing properly, you should clean them frequently. It is recommended to clean the frames with an unbleached white cloth soaked in soapy water or solvent. Pay special attention to the corners where dirt may build up. You can also employ a Stanley knife to remove the beads from the frame.

    It's also an excellent idea to lubricate the rollers and hinges on your uPVC windows so that they don't start to rattle when you open or close them. A good lubricant for Window repairs plastic windows is WD-40 that can be purchased at most hardware stores. You should clean off the WD-40 afterwards, as it can stain your uPVC windows.

    Broken or loose hinges

    The most common cause for window problems with upvc is broken or loose hinges. The hinges can be replaced to fix the problem. You will then be in a position to open and close your window in a normal manner. This is a cost-effective easy, window repairs quick and quick repair that will save money on replacement windows.

    Our upvc window are fitted with friction hinges. They are generally used for side-hung windows, but they can be used on top-hung windows too. They are available in a 13mm or 17mm stack and are sold in two. They are normally replaced when there are gaps around the sash, draughts felt around the hinge or where the sash is difficult to open.

    It is important to read the directions and follow the opening directions when installing a new upvc hinge. An arrow is located on the hinge. For the window to function properly, the arrow has to point in the direction of opening. If you are unsure about the type of hinge you should purchase, contact us and we will be more than happy to help.

    It is important to lubricate your window hinges regularly. It will enable the sash to slide open and close easily and prevent cracking or warping of the upvc window. You can apply a light engineering oil containing corrosion inhibitors to lubricate the hinges on your upvc window. This is recommended to be done at least every two years.

    This is a great way to maintain your window and keep it in good working condition. Also, make sure that the hinges don't appear to be loose or damaged. Small adjustments to the screws can be made to fix this issue and you will not face any issues with your window repairs near me.

    This is a fairly easy repair, but it could require some time to find the correct screw size to tighten them. It is important to note that the screws can become loose if they are not used regularly, so they should be checked and tightened at least once a year.
